Overhead humidity control that keeps your floor space free
The Quest 70 is a professional dehumidifier built for sealed rooms and tight spaces, and it is the 50 Hz international model — 230V, so it runs on a normal UK supply with no transformer. It mounts overhead or stands on the floor, and at 25 kg in a 53.3 x 30.5 x 30.5 cm body it takes up far less room than its output suggests. ⚑ Its water-removal figure is quoted at 26.7°C and 60% RH — realistic room conditions, not the 32°C / 80% RH that flatters most competitors' numbers.
Key Benefits
- 26 litres a day at 26.7°C and 60% RH
- 2.22 litres per kWh — among the lowest running costs in its class
- Only 2.1 amps and 480 watts, so it frees up electricity for other equipment
- MERV 13 filtration captures dust, pollen and mould spores as it dries the air
- Overhead or ground placement — hanging kit available separately
- Onboard dehumidistat plus a low voltage terminal block for external control
- Auto restart returns to your previous settings after a power cut
- 7 metre power cord for reach without an extension lead
Air that will not dry out, in a room with no space to spare
In a sealed room, every litre your plants drink is transpired straight back into the air. Once relative humidity climbs and stays there you get condensation on cold surfaces, mould on damp material and a root zone that stops drawing water because the air will not take any more. The Quest 70 holds humidity at a set point instead of chasing it, and because it works across a 5°C to 35°C range it keeps doing so when the room runs cold at night or hot under lights.
How to Use
- Stand it on the floor or hang it overhead — both are supported; the hanging kit is a separate accessory
- Plug it in. No installation, no commissioning
- Set your target humidity on the onboard dehumidistat, or drive it from an external controller through the terminal block
- Run a drain line from the 1.9 cm threaded outlet, and ⚑ fit a P-trap — this model needs one
- Duct the intake and exhaust with the duct kit if you need to move air to a specific part of the room
- ⚑ Change the MERV 13 filter every cycle. Most faults on these units trace back to a blocked filter, not the machine
Technical Specifications
- Model: 4033810-XX (Quest 70, 50 Hz international)
- Water removal: 26 litres/day at 26.7°C and 60% RH
- Efficiency: 2.22 litres/kWh
- Power: 480 W
- Current draw: 2.1 A
- Supply voltage: 230V, 50 Hz
- Airflow: 255 m³/hr (150 CFM)
- Operating temperature: 5°C to 35°C
- Dimensions: 53.3 (L) x 30.5 (W) x 30.5 (H) cm
- Weight: 25 kg
- Filtration: MERV 13, filter size 23 x 28 x 3 cm
- Controls: onboard dehumidistat with low voltage terminal block
- Power cord: 7 m, IEC 60320-C13
- Refrigerant: R410A, 15 oz
- Drain connection: 1.9 cm threaded NPT
- Warranty: 3 years
- Compliance: CE rated
